plasma-contracts is the set of smart contracts written in Vyper for the Plasma Group series of projects. It includes an implementation of a Plasma Cash variant, and a registry contract for discovering Plasma chains. This repo is used for compiling those contracts--If you don't need any modifications, you can spin up your own with plasma-chain-operator or try out other chains with plasma-js-lib.

Requirements and Setup

The first step is cloning this repo. Via https:

$ git clone https://github.com/plasma-group/plasma-contracts.git

or ssh:

$ git clone git@github.com:plasma-group/plasma-contracts.git

Node.js

plasma-contracts is tested with Node.js and has been tested on the following versions of Node:

  • 11.6.0

If you're having trouble getting plasma-contracts tests running, please make sure you have one of the above Node.js versions installed.

Packages

plasma-contracts makes use of several npm packages.

Install all required packages with:

$ npm install

Python and Vyper

plasma-contracts is written in Vyper, a pythonic Ethereum smart contract language. You'll need Python 3.6 or above to install Vyper.

We reccomend setting up a virtual environment instead of installing globally:

python3 -m venv venv

To activate:

$ source venv/bin/activate

Install Vyper:

pip3 install vyper

Your venv must be activated whenever testing or otherwise using Vyper, but it will break the npm install, so be sure to $ deactivate if you still need to do that and reactivate afterwards.

Running Tests

plasma-contracts makes use of a combination of Mocha (a testing framework) and Chai (an assertion library) for testing.

Run all tests with:

$ npm test

So that Python and Vyper aren't requirements for our other components, we do include a compiled-contracts folder which contains JS exports of the bytecode and ABI. Compilation is done automatically before testing.
